What is the difference between Contract Cad Software Developer vs CAD Designer?

AspectContract CAD Software DeveloperCAD Designer
Required CredentialsProficiency in CAD software, programming skills, relevant certificationsProficiency in CAD software, design skills, relevant certifications
Work EnvironmentProject-based, often remote or on-site, technical focusDesign studios, engineering firms, on-site or remote, creative focus
Employer & Industry UsageEngineering, manufacturing, architecture firms hiring for technical developmentArchitectural, product design, engineering firms focusing on design creation

Contract CAD Software Developers focus on creating and customizing CAD software solutions, requiring programming skills and technical expertise. CAD Designers primarily work on creating detailed designs and drawings using CAD tools. While both roles require CAD proficiency, their focus and responsibilities differ significantly, catering to different project needs within the industry.

How much do contract cad software developers make?

Contract CAD software developers typically earn between $40 and $80 per hour, depending on experience, location, and project complexity. Senior developers with specialized skills in CAD tools like AutoCAD or SolidWorks may command higher rates, especially for complex or long-term projects.

Position Summary
This role will lead complex new product introduction launches from early project planning through production ramp-up and stabilization. You will coordinate cross-functional teams, supplier partners, equipment readiness, automation integration, launch risk management, and executive reporting to deliver safe, reliable, and on-time manufacturing outcomes.
Key Responsibilities:
Project Planning and Execution
  • Define Project Scope: Outline clear project goals, deliverables, and resource requirements in collaboration with senior leadership and plant management.
  • Launch Timelines: Create, maintain, and track master schedules, managing critical path milestones across cross-functional teams to meet strict market launch dates.
  • Budget & Cost Tracking: Manage project budgets, including capital expenses (CapEx) for new tooling and equipment, cost targets and financial variances to keep projects within budget.

Shop Floor and Process Optimization
  • Oversee Capital Expenditures (CapEx): Manage the procurement, installation, and commissioning of new manufacturing equipment, assembly lines, or facility expansions.
  • Coordinate Operations: Work directly with plant managers, engineers, procurement, quality assurance, and floor supervisors to prevent production bottlenecks during project rollouts.

Supply Chain and Quality Assurance
  • Supplier Readiness: Work with procurement to source raw materials and ensure external vendors are ready to supply components at the required volume and quality.
  • Quality & Testing: Establish quality control plans, testing procedures, and assembly documentation (Work Instructions) specifically tailored for the new products.

Risk and Quality Management
  • Ensure Compliance: Maintain strict adherence to industry regulations, OSHA safety standards, and company quality management systems (e.g., ISO 9001).
  • Quality Control: Ensure all project outputs meet exact engineering drawings, client specifications, and performance metrics.

Stakeholder Communication
  • Lead Teams: Facilitate regular cross-functional meetings between engineering, supply chain, production, finance, and external vendors. Serve as the primary escalation point for high-impact, complex, or cross-functional issues while using critical thinking, communication, problem-solving, compliance, and financial controls to keep launches aligned to schedule, budget, quality, safety, and business commitments.
  • Status Reporting: Provide clear, data-driven progress updates and performance metrics to executive stakeholders.

Key Requirements &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ical, Industrial, or Electrical Engineering, Operations Management, or a related technical field.
  • 5-7 years of experience in project management within the manufacturing industry.
  • Proficiency with PLM (Product Lifecycle Management) software, ERP systems (e.g., SAP, Oracle), and master scheduling tools (e.g., MS Project, Asana).
  • Familiarity with ASTM, AISI, and ICC standards for cladding and building envelope systems.
  • Certifications: PMP (Project Management Professional) or Certified Lean Six Sigma Green/Black Belt is highly preferred.
  • Technical Skills: Ability to interpret 2D/3D engineering drawings (CAD blueprints) and manage complex Bills of Materials (BOMs).
  • Software Proficiency: Strong skills in project management tools (e.g., MS Project, Jira, Asana) and ERP systems (e.g., SAP, Oracle).
  • Technical Knowledge: Ability to read engineering drawings, blueprints, and understand standard manufacturing processes (e.g., machining, assembly, automation).
